My Wuglyee Dilemma

     I've got so much to tell you over the coming week! There's really been a lot going on with me over the last couple of days!! Just keep your eye on my blog to find out. But for now...HELP!!!
   The scarf in the header picture is my Half A Peacock Scarf that's in my Etsy shop right now. It is one of my 'Wuglyee' scarves. In other words, it was made out of yarns and thread that I had leftover from other projects. And therein lies my dilemma. I got a request for a custom order to make a scarf like this one below...
    This is my Hot Pink and Black Stripe and Block Scarf (also in my Etsy shop right now by the way). The customer would like this scarf, without the blocks at the bottom, but with the stripes going all the way down...No problem! They'd like the black stripe to remain...Again, No problem! But they'd like the green part of this scarf...
    ...to be the color that goes alongside the black......PROBLEM!!! Do you see the actually color of this green conglomerate?!
    Well, there is no such yarn! I made it up by crocheting a lot of different yarns and threads together. I don't have any of the threads anymore, nor do I remember which ones they were! And if I COULD remember, I'm not sure I'd be able to get them from somewhere again! This scarf is, in every sense of the word, a ONE OF A KIND!  It has different shades of blue, yellow, different shades of green, some burnt red, etc... That's why I called it Half A Peacock, because he had all of these colors but when they were put all together they looked like a peacock's plumage.
